WebScotland There are no statutory restrictions on the killing of game on Sunday or Christmas Day but it is not customary to do so. Season … WebShooting Seasons UK Wild game can only be shot during certain times of the year and for many species there is a close season during which time it is illegal to shoot them. This is to ensure that the species continue to flourish and are not hunted to extinction. Below is a list of all the dates within the UK. GAME BIRDS Coot - UK - 1st Sept-31st Jan
